In order for your home to reach cool temperatures consistently, it relies on an AC system. This is something you need to maintain time and time again. Here are some reasons why regular AC maintenance matters today.

Help You Avoid Fire Hazards

Although an AC unit is designed to produce cool air, some of its components can get hot. This can happen when they're overworked and it can get to the point when they become a fire hazard. For this reason, you want to perform the right maintenance steps for this unit.

This will keep components working efficiently and they thus won't be able to get too hot, so you can alleviate the risk of a fire hazard later on in the future. You just need to keep up with the proper maintenance protocols that are specifically designed for your residential cooling system.

Save a Lot of Money on Energy Bills

Homeowners that stop caring about their AC unit's maintenance can probably expect their energy bills to go up. That's because major parts will get neglected and subsequently stop working efficiently, which will have a direct impact on energy costs. 

So if you don't want these bills getting too high to where you can't afford to keep the lights on, put ample focus on residential AC maintenance. It doesn't even have to be that hard. You just need to be consistent, utilize strategy, and maintain the right parts that require the most care. 

Avoid Bad Air Quality

If you don't do enough to maintain your AC unit properly, then something that could happen is your air quality degrades over time. Parts may get dirty and this can make the air ducts collect dirt and debris. You will then breathe these things in when your AC unit runs.

You can stop this from happening if you just decide to keep parts of your AC unit clean. That includes the air filter, vents, and any other part that collects dirt over time. You might need to study parts of your AC unit to see which components are more vulnerable to getting dirty. Then you can put more focus on them when cleaning. 

If you don't want to face complications with your AC unit, maintenance is something that you should care about and focus on throughout the year. If you work hard and perform the right routines, you can see a lot of great payoffs that ultimately save you money and stress as a homeowner.
